Job Overview

A law firm seeks a Corporate Associate to join its Health Care Practice Group in Denver, CO. This full-time position involves working on sophisticated transactional matters for private equity and financial sponsor clients. The role offers exposure to clients across various industries, with a focus on health care and regulated sectors.

Duties

  • Structure, negotiate, and execute complex transactions.
  • Draft and negotiate transaction documents for M&A transactions.
  • Prepare and negotiate governing documents, including bylaws and operating agreements.
  • Manage key aspects of transactions with increasing independence.
  • Coordinate due diligence and supervise junior attorneys.
  • Work directly with clients and collaborate within deal teams.

Requirements

  • 3-4 years of experience with private equity funds and M&A transactions.
  • Strong academic background and superior drafting skills.
  • Admitted to the Colorado Bar.
  • Willingness to participate in community and professional organizations.

Education

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ree required.

Certifications

  • Admission to the Colorado Bar.

Skills

  • Diligent, detail-oriented, and proactive.
  • Team-oriented and personable.
